WebMar 31, 2024 · Let’s suppose you’ve got a legacy optical system that produces a beam that comes to a focus at f/8, and you want to collimate this beam at a diameter of approximately 80mm. In this case, we will need a 640mm focal length collimator (80mm beam diameter multiplied by the f-number of 8), and a good choice would be SORL’s 25-055-04 mirror ...

WebMicro-optics (or microoptics) is the field of optics dealing with particularly small optical components. The small physical dimensions have various implications concerning fabrication techniques, usable optical materials, relevant physical effects, performance limitations and the practical handling. WebA goal of the optical design is to make the head as small as possible with a collimated output beam as large in diameter as possible. This requires what in camera language is called a very fast lens, i.e. a lens with a very low f/number. Note that a 35mm camera lens rated at f/1.4 is considered fast.
